Monday, August 6, 2012 at 4:09AM 'Scary Movie 5' to Welcome Lindsay Lohan & Charlie Sheen

I guess, if anything, it should be noted that Dimension Films Scary Movie franchise is a job creator and continues to offer work to actors where no one else will. Keeping in this tradition Lindsay Lohan and Charlie Sheen are set to join the cast of Scary Movie 5, so say reports from E!. Sheen isn’t so much of a surprise as he was already in both Scary Movie 3 and 4. The pair joins Ashley Tisdale of High School Musical. Comedian Kevin Hart is also rumored to be involved.
I’d like to say something about optimistic about Malcolm D. Lee directing because I have a soft spot for Undercover Brother but honestly, there’s only so much you can do with a franchise that was beating a dead horse two movies ago.
The plot, as though it even matters at this point, will revolve around three dancers who compete for an important lead in a new production. Veteran dancer Heather Daltry, played by Lohan, gets cut in favor of the younger, perkier dancers and goes crazy. Mayhem and hilarity supposedly will ensue. I’m also assuming that there will be lots of stale pop culture jokes to go with your stale popcorn.
It's probably not necessary that you’ve seen the previous four films to jump right in. The film is prepped for release on April 19, 2013.
